Types of Facade Systems
Facade systems can be categorized into several types, each optimized for specific applications and architectural styles:
- Curtain Wall Systems: These are non-structural cladding systems that hang on the building’s structural frame. They allow for large expanses of glass, essential for modern architectural aesthetics.
- Panel Systems: They consist of solid panels, often pre-fabricated before being installed on-site, allowing for quick installations and reduced labor efforts.
- Rain Screen Facade Systems: These systems are designed to protect against water penetration while ensuring ventilation, thus enhancing the building’s longevity and performance.
- Modular Facades: Prefabricated sections that can be quickly assembled on-site. These facades offer high efficiency in construction and contribute to waste reduction.
Common Materials Used for Facade Installation
The selection of materials for facade systems is extensive and plays a significant role in both durability and aesthetics. Some of the most common materials include:
- Glass: Offers natural light and aesthetic appeal. Glass facades can be highly energy-efficient when treated properly.
- Metal: Materials like aluminum and steel are favored for their longevity, lightweight properties, and sleek finishes.
- Brick: A classic choice known for its durability and aesthetic appeal, particularly in traditional architecture.
- Stone: Provides a natural look with excellent durability, often used in high-end projects.
- Cementious materials: Such materials, including fiber cement, are increasingly popular due to their low maintenance and durability.

Challenges in Facade Installation
Even with the best planning, several challenges may arise during the installation of facades. Understanding these challenges can help mitigate their impact.
Weather and Site Conditions
Unpredictable weather can hinder installation activities. It is essential to plan for:
- Wind and Rain: Both conditions can adversely affect the installation process, especially for high-rise projects.
- Temperature Extremes: Extreme cold or heat can affect the curing of adhesives and the operation of machinery.
- Site Accessibility: Ensure that the site can be easily accessed for both workers and materials throughout the installation phase.
Technical Issues and Solutions
Technical challenges may arise due to the complexity of facade systems. Some common issues include the failure of anchoring systems or miscalculations during installation. To address them:
- Regular Testing: Implement routine testing of anchors and fittings to ensure they meet safety standards.
- Experience and Training: Invest in proper training for workers to enhance their skills in troubleshooting and resolving technical issues as they arise.
